our Letter of the 31st October last with the
Original and Copies of Correspondence upon
the subject matter of our complaint, which we took the liberty to send accompanying, it is presumed unnecessary to trouble the Right Honorable the Secretary of State for the Colonies with any further details of our grievance through the unjustifiable Police prosecution complained of, at the instance of the Postmaster General of this Colony.
Only we may add that had not the Summons been served (apparently for a purpose) at our residence, a considerable distance from the Magistracy, scarcely an hour preceding our required appearance in the Police Court, we would have been prepared with legal advice, and adduced respectable exculpatory testimony on our own part, as well as in reprobation of the Postmaster's high-handed proceeding, not alone towards ourselves, but to the general public, who were likewise impatient for the overdue delivery of Overland mail despatches close to the eleventh hour of night!
